The Teacher Task Force is pleased to announce that the global celebrations of World Teachers’ Day 2025 will take place on 3 October 2025 in Addis Ababa, Ethiopia, in conjunction with the Pan African Conference on Teachers’ Education (PACTED 2025), under the theme Recasting teaching as a collaborative profession.
Celebrated annually since 1994, World Teachers’ Day commemorates the adoption of the 1966 ILO/UNESCO Recommendation concerning the Status of Teachers—the international standard setting out teachers’ rights, responsibilities, and working conditions—as well as the 1997 Recommendation on Higher-Education Teaching Personnel. The day honours the transformative role of teachers in shaping education and reflects on the support they need to fully realise their potential.
The celebrations will the occasion to launch the Teacher Task Force & UNESCO Institute for Statistics fact sheet highlighting promising approaches showing how collaboration may support teaching quality, increase teacher retention, enhance learning outcomes and empower teachers to contribute as agents of change in their schools and communities. World Teachers’ Day is convened by the Teacher Task Force members UNESCO, the International Labour Organization (ILO), UNICEF, and Education International (EI).
